How do you do the purple ones? They are so good

5

u/Whereisnyx 12d ago

Start by applying your chosen base color over the entire nail, then cure it fully. Next, apply a thin layer of top coat without curing it then use a fine liner brush, pick up a small amount of dark purple and draw delicate, fluid strokes directly into the uncured top coat. The wet layer allows the color to blend softly and creates that featherly effect . Once you're happy with the design, cure it
